20// 4.5.1 Primary type categories
21
22#include <tr1/type_traits>
23#include <testsuite_hooks.h>
24#include <testsuite_tr1.h>
25
26void test01()
27{
22931aa4
PC
28 using std::tr1::is_union;
29 using namespace __gnu_test;
30
31 // Positive tests.
32 VERIFY( (test_category<is_union, UnionType>(true)) );
33
34 // Negative tests.
35 VERIFY( (test_category<is_union, ClassType>(false)) );
36 VERIFY( (test_category<is_union, DerivedType>(false)) );
37 VERIFY( (test_category<is_union, ConvType>(false)) );
38 VERIFY( (test_category<is_union, AbstractClass>(false)) );
39 VERIFY( (test_category<is_union, PolymorphicClass>(false)) );
40 VERIFY( (test_category<is_union, DerivedPolymorphic>(false)) );
41 VERIFY( (test_category<is_union, void>(false)) );
42 VERIFY( (test_category<is_union, int>(false)) );
43 VERIFY( (test_category<is_union, float>(false)) );
44 VERIFY( (test_category<is_union, int[2]>(false)) );
45 VERIFY( (test_category<is_union, int*>(false)) );
46 VERIFY( (test_category<is_union, int(*)(int)>(false)) );
47 VERIFY( (test_category<is_union, float&>(false)) );
48 VERIFY( (test_category<is_union, float(&)(float)>(false)) );
49 VERIFY( (test_category<is_union, int (ClassType::*)>(false)) );
50 VERIFY( (test_category<is_union, int (ClassType::*) (int)>(false)) );
51 VERIFY( (test_category<is_union, int (int)>(false)) );
52 VERIFY( (test_category<is_union, EnumType>(false)) );
53}
54
55int main()
56{
57 test01();
58 return 0;
59}
